Nie jesteś zalogowany.
Jeśli nie posiadasz konta, zarejestruj je już teraz! Pozwoli Ci ono w pełni korzystać z naszego serwisu. Spamerom dziękujemy!

Ogłoszenie

Prosimy o pomoc dla małej Julki — przekaż 1% podatku na Fundacji Dzieciom zdazyć z Pomocą.
Więcej informacji na dug.net.pl/pomagamy/.

#1  2012-05-27 18:25:30

  zdzisiu316 - Użytkownik

zdzisiu316
Użytkownik
Zarejestrowany: 2012-05-27

Grub rescue po wyjęciu pendrive z netinstall.

Witam, jest to mój pierwszy post tak więc przepraszam za błędy, itp i proszę o wyrozumiałość.
Zainstalowałem Debiana obok Windowsa 7 za pomocą UNetbootin (Testing_NetInstall). Gdy wyjmę pendrive i chcę uruchomić system wyświetla mi się coś takiego:

Kod:

GRUB loading.
Welcome to GRUB!

error: so such device: 67050535-8373-4639-ac41-9c99cba38a9e.
Entering rescue mode. . .
grub rescue>

Co zrobić żeby komputer startował mi normalnie bez pendrive?

Offline

 

#2  2012-05-27 18:26:15

  mer - Członek DUG

mer
Członek DUG
Zarejestrowany: 2010-08-05

Re: Grub rescue po wyjęciu pendrive z netinstall.

odbudować gruba przez live cd i chroot ;)


http://img811.imageshack.us/img811/2851/sygnas.png

Offline

 

#3  2012-05-27 18:29:29

  zdzisiu316 - Użytkownik

zdzisiu316
Użytkownik
Zarejestrowany: 2012-05-27

Re: Grub rescue po wyjęciu pendrive z netinstall.

Można troszkę jaśniej i dokładniej?

Offline

 

#4  2012-05-27 18:45:54

  krasnij - oj tam

krasnij
oj tam
Skąd: z JO73VT
Zarejestrowany: 2012-05-04
Serwis

Re: Grub rescue po wyjęciu pendrive z netinstall.

Miałem taki sam przypadek. GRUB zainstalował się na pendrive. Włóż pendrive i powinno normalnie załadować GRUB'a. Po odpaleniu systemu wpisz

Kod:

# grub-install /dev/sda

Jeżeli wszystko pójdzie ok to:

Kod:

# update-grub

Co do używania chroota to odsyłam do artykułu na naszym portalu:

http://dug.net.pl/tekst/77/przywracanie_grub2_za_pomoca_chroot/

Ostatnio edytowany przez krasnij (2012-05-27 18:48:24)


Pozdrawiam i życzę sukcesów :)
The truth is out there.

Offline

 

#5  2012-05-27 18:54:46

  zdzisiu316 - Użytkownik

zdzisiu316
Użytkownik
Zarejestrowany: 2012-05-27

Re: Grub rescue po wyjęciu pendrive z netinstall.

Po wpisaniu:

Kod:

# grub-install /dev/sda

otrzymałem:

Kod:

/usr/sbin/grub-setup: warn: This GPT partition label has no BIOS Boot Partition; embedding won't be possible!.
/usr/sbin/grub-setup: warn: Embedding is not possible.  GRUB can only be installed in this setup by using blocklists.  However, blocklists are UNRELIABLE and their use is discouraged..
/usr/sbin/grub-setup: error: will not proceed with blocklists.

Offline

 

#6  2012-05-27 19:23:16

  krasnij - oj tam

krasnij
oj tam
Skąd: z JO73VT
Zarejestrowany: 2012-05-04
Serwis

Re: Grub rescue po wyjęciu pendrive z netinstall.

Podaj wynik polecenia

Kod:

# fdisk -l

Pozdrawiam i życzę sukcesów :)
The truth is out there.

Offline

 

#7  2012-05-27 19:29:58

  lx - Użytkownik

lx
Użytkownik
Zarejestrowany: 2010-06-22

Re: Grub rescue po wyjęciu pendrive z netinstall.

Przy tablicy partycji GPT trzeba utworzyć GRUB-owi niewielką, niesformatową partycję (wystarczy 1MB) na jego potrzeby. W parted wygląda to tak:

Kod:

# parted /dev/sda
GNU Parted 2.3
Using /dev/sda
Welcome to GNU Parted! Type 'help' to view a list of commands.
(parted) print                                                            
Model: ATA C300-CTFDDAC064M (scsi)
Disk /dev/sda: 64,0GB
Sector size (logical/physical): 512B/512B
Partition Table: gpt

Number  Start   End     Size    File system     Name                 Flags
 1      1049kB  3146kB  2097kB                  BIOS boot partition  bios_grub
 2      3146kB  21,5GB  21,5GB  ext4            /
 3      21,5GB  25,8GB  4293MB  linux-swap(v1)  Linux swap
 4      25,8GB  64,0GB  38,3GB  ext4            /home

Offline

 

#8  2012-05-27 22:43:02

  Yampress - Imperator

Yampress
Imperator
Zarejestrowany: 2007-10-18

Re: Grub rescue po wyjęciu pendrive z netinstall.

Offline

 

#9  2012-05-27 23:01:05

  zdzisiu316 - Użytkownik

zdzisiu316
Użytkownik
Zarejestrowany: 2012-05-27

Re: Grub rescue po wyjęciu pendrive z netinstall.

Wynik polecenia:

Kod:

# fdisk -l

Kod:

Dysk /dev/sda: 60.0 GB, bajtów: 60022480896
głowic: 255, sektorów/ścieżkę: 63, cylindrów: 7297, w sumie sektorów: 117231408
Jednostka = sektorów, czyli 1 * 512 = 512 bajtów
Rozmiar sektora (logiczny/fizyczny) w bajtach: 512 / 512
Rozmiar we/wy (minimalny/optymalny) w bajtach: 512 / 512
Identyfikator dysku: 0x53cedfac

Urządzenie Rozruch   Początek      Koniec   Bloków   ID  System
/dev/sda1            2048      206847      102400    7  HPFS/NTFS/exFAT
/dev/sda2          206848   117125119    58459136    7  HPFS/NTFS/exFAT
/dev/sda3   *   117125120   117229567       52224   83  Linux

UWAGA: Na '/dev/sdb' wykryto tablicę partycji GPT (GUID Partition Table)! fdisk nie obsługuje GPT. Należy użyć GNU Parteda.


Dysk /dev/sdb: 500.1 GB, bajtów: 500107862016
głowic: 255, sektorów/ścieżkę: 63, cylindrów: 60801, w sumie sektorów: 976773168
Jednostka = sektorów, czyli 1 * 512 = 512 bajtów
Rozmiar sektora (logiczny/fizyczny) w bajtach: 512 / 512
Rozmiar we/wy (minimalny/optymalny) w bajtach: 512 / 512
Identyfikator dysku: 0xb21cb21c

Urządzenie Rozruch   Początek      Koniec   Bloków   ID  System
/dev/sdb1               1   976773167   488386583+  ee  GPT

Dysk /dev/sdc: 15.7 GB, bajtów: 15716057088
głowic: 61, sektorów/ścieżkę: 61, cylindrów: 8249, w sumie sektorów: 30695424
Jednostka = sektorów, czyli 1 * 512 = 512 bajtów
Rozmiar sektora (logiczny/fizyczny) w bajtach: 512 / 512
Rozmiar we/wy (minimalny/optymalny) w bajtach: 512 / 512
Identyfikator dysku: 0xc3072e18

Urządzenie Rozruch   Początek      Koniec   Bloków   ID  System
/dev/sdc1   *        8064    30695423    15343680    c  W95 FAT32 (LBA)

sdc - pendrive
sda - ssd z zainstalowaną 7

Przy próbie instalowania gruba na jakiejkolwiek utworzonej partycji (za pomocą gparted) wynik:

Kod:

/usr/sbin/grub-setup: warn: Attempting to install GRUB to a partitionless disk or to a partition.  This is a BAD idea..
/usr/sbin/grub-setup: error: embedding is not possible, but this is required for cross-disk install.

Ostatnio edytowany przez zdzisiu316 (2012-05-27 23:02:11)

Offline

 

#10  2012-05-27 23:06:02

  mer - Członek DUG

mer
Członek DUG
Zarejestrowany: 2010-08-05

Re: Grub rescue po wyjęciu pendrive z netinstall.

gruba się instaluje na dysk a nie na partycję. On trzyma swoje pliki tylko w /boot


http://img811.imageshack.us/img811/2851/sygnas.png

Offline

 

#11  2012-05-28 08:55:25

  zdzisiu316 - Użytkownik

zdzisiu316
Użytkownik
Zarejestrowany: 2012-05-27

Re: Grub rescue po wyjęciu pendrive z netinstall.

Dzięki wszystkim zainteresowanym :) wreszcie działa jak należy.

Offline

 

Stopka forum

Powered by PunBB
© Copyright 2002–2005 Rickard Andersson
Możesz wyłączyć AdBlock — tu nie ma reklam ;-)